Struct rubbl_fits::ParsedHdu [−][src]
Information about an HDU in a parsed FITS file.
Implementations
impl ParsedHdu
[src]
pub fn extname(&self) -> &str
[src]
Get the “name” of this HDU. If this is an extension HDU, this is the value of the EXTNAME header keyword. For the primary HDU, it is an empty string.
pub fn kind(&self) -> HduKind
[src]
Query what kind of HDU this is.
pub fn bitpix(&self) -> Bitpix
[src]
Query the “BITPIX” of this HDU, which defines the format in which its data are stored.
pub fn shape(&self) -> (usize, isize, &[usize])
[src]
Query the shape of this HDU’s data. Returns (gcount, pcount, naxis)
.
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for ParsedHdu
impl Send for ParsedHdu
impl Sync for ParsedHdu
impl Unpin for ParsedHdu
impl UnwindSafe for ParsedHdu
Blanket Implementations
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> Borrow<T> for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
T: ?Sized,
pub f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> From<T> for T
[src]
impl<T, U> Into<U> for T where
U: From<T>,
[src]
U: From<T>,
impl<T> ToOwned for T where
T: Clone,
[src]
T: Clone,
type Owned = T
The resulting type after obtaining ownership.
pub fn to_owned(&self) -> T
[src]
pub fn clone_into(&self, target: &mut T)
[src]
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
pub f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,